Convocation
of Sri Sathya Sai Institute of Higher Learning
The
Convocation of the Sri Sathya Sai Institute of Higher Learning
is celebrated on the 22nd of November every year. Bhagawan,
as the Chancellor of the University, along with the Chief
Guest leads the procession consisting of the members of the
Academic Council and the Governing Body of the Institute onto
the dais. After all the esteemed members are seated on the
dais, Bhagawan declares the Convocation open to the thunderous
applause of the multitudes. Later, the Principal presents
the outgoing students to the Chancellor and then Baba blesses
the students and Himself gives away the medals and certificates
to the outstanding performers. The Vice Chancellor then administers
the Convocation oath to the graduands. 
Then, the Chief Guest addresses the graduands.
Following this, Bhagawan blesses all the students with His
benedictory message. The function concludes with the National
Anthem. The day’s proceedings conclude with a cultural
programme presented by the students of the Institute.
Excerpts from
Bhagawan’s Discourses:
“Students,
Boys and Girls!
Give up selfishness. Develop the spirit of
sacrifice. Be prepared to sacrifice your life for the sake
of Sathya and Dharma (truth and righteousness). Today people
are afraid to follow the path of truth. Why should one be
afraid to speak truth? In fact, one should be afraid to utter
falsehood. One who adheres to truth is always fearless. When
you do not follow the path of truth, the fire of fear will
burn you to ashes.
Embodiments
of Love!
Consider love as your life and truth as your breath. There
is an intimate and inseparable relationship between love and
truth. Today, man uses the word ‘love’ without
actually knowing its meaning. As he does not know the value
and meaning of love, he is utilizing it for trivial and mundane
purposes. He is under the mistaken notion that worldly and
physical attachment is love and considers such love as his
life. True love will reign supreme only when he gets rid of
selfishness and develops spirit of sacrifice. Love is God,
God is love. But you are craving for worldly love which is
bereft of life. You should aspire for divine love which is
your very life.
Today, there are many who are highly educated.
But, of what help are they to society? Practically nothing!
They are acquiring degrees for the sake of earning money.
They do not serve society with the spirit of love and sacrifice.
Love is the very form of Brahman. True spiritual discipline
lies in connecting your love with divine love. Your life will
be sanctified when you have steady and selfless love”.
- Divine Discourse: November 22, 2003
"Dear Students!
You must protect the honour of this great
country. You must develop self-respect. One who has lost self-respect,
cannot attain glory. Self-respect comes only out of spiritual
practice. Today, students wish to achieve wealth, physical
strength and a wide circle of friends. What about character?
Of what use is it to have the above three, without character?
Therefore, you must give first preference to character. When
you respect others, others will respect you. You complain
that others are not respecting you. But, did you enquire whether
you are respecting others? Only when you serve others will
others serve you. What you expect from others, you extend
it to others first”.
- Divine Discourse: November 22, 2002
